Transaction 31a8904cc56d744f5668a1eaa028dfbe9535ccc41eef1354f59483ce2a55231b
1 Input
1 Output
-
31a8904cc56d744f5668a1eaa028dfbe9535ccc41eef1354f59483ce2a55231b:0
- value
- 11750000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 71318d2891bae60827ff3a7135a0e01904361ff8 OP_EQUAL
- address
- 3C1Xe7TqFoZFmCp1buX7JiJbj37KPxkJn5